Ralph Hazenhitl’s team earned their fourth win (there was also a draw) in February as they beat Norwich 2-0 in their 27th Premier League game while they have lost since January 15. The Canaries, who are in last place with 17 points, remain in a difficult position. In ninth place with 35 the “Saints”.

In the 37th minute, Southampton took the lead with a place through Adams after the hosts initially stole the ball. In the second half, the “Saints” continued to threaten and in 88′ they closed the game.

The Norwich defense drew away from a corner kick from the left and the ball landed on Romeu, who made it 2-0 with a running shot. Dimitris Giannoulis stayed on the bench.
